I am with Monte on this one. I'm all for it if they change the layout. I really liked the Bahrain doubleheader. Silverstone and RedBull ring were better than nothing, but not great during round 2.
If they can change the Silverstone layout that would be good. RedBull short track (but that may be too short). They could also try different layouts at Paul Ricard very easily.

Im not a huge fan of the double whammy rounds and see them as just a workaround solution tor Liberty to get their number of races up to meet broadcasting contracts. Bahrain was fun because the track variations. Even changing tyre compounds doesnt work really other than providing drama like at Silverstone where we had a number of tyre failures because of changes. I dont enjoy the low speed tyre conservation races .
